    Marriage Certificate - Maria Buchanan Aitken and Adam Schwebel
    Marriage Certificate - Maria Buchanan Aitken and Adam Schwebel
    Married 16 Jan 1882 in Sydney, New South Wales. Husband, a widower, born in Darmstadt, Germany: age 52, a builder, father Michael, mother Eva [...], father a farmer. Bride, a spinster, born in Sterlingshire, Scotland: age 30, father Walter Aitken, mother Martha [...], father a general merchant. Both resident in Marrickville, married in accordance with the rites of the Presbyterian Church.

    Maria Buchanan Aitken Schwebel Grave - Rookwood Cemetery
    Maria Buchanan Aitken Schwebel Grave - Rookwood Cemetery
    Burial at Rookwood Independent Cemetery, New South Wales. Buried 8 Sep 1885. Inscription reads: "In Memory of Maria Buchanan the beloved wife of Adam Schwöbel who died 8th Sept 1885 aged 35 years. Also Ernest infant son of the above, died 19th Oct 1885 aged 4 months."

    The verse is from the hymn "Submissive to Thy Will My God" by Thomas Haweis 1734-1820. The hymn is as follows:

    Submissive to thy will, my God,
    I all to thee resign,
    And bow before thy chastening rod,
    I mourn, but not repine.

    Why should my foolish heart complain,
    Where wisdom, truth, and love
    Direct the stroke, inflict the pain
    And point to joys above?

    How short are all my sufferings here,
    How needful every cross;
    Away, my unbelieving fear
    Nor call my gain my loss.

    Then give, dear Lord, or take away,
    I'll bless thy sacred name;
    My Jesus, yesterday, to-day,
    Forever is the same.

    Plot: Independent - Section OG, Grave 2123
